> After the Civil War, the 14th Amendment said the “whole number of persons in each state” should be counted. The agent’s statement that “the more people that you lose in Minnesota, you then lose a voting right to stay blue” could be a reference to deportations changing the “apportionment” of seats in Congress every decade.
